Nestled in the vibrant heart of South London, Peckham Rye train station is a gateway to a dynamic community and a focal point for rail travel. Established in 1865, this station has become an essential stop for commuters, tourists, and locals alike. With its substantial facilities, Peckham Rye ensures your ticketing needs are well catered to. Operating throughout the week, the ticket office is open from 06:10 to 19:45 from Monday to Saturday, and slightly reduced hours on Sundays, closing at 16:20. For tech-savvy travelers, ticket machines are available on-site and are equipped to handle a variety of transactions, including those with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Collecting tickets purchased online is a breeze at these machines, and smartcard validators are present for a swift journey through the gates.
Aside from ticketing, accessibility and support are a priority despite the station's Category C accessibility status, which means it's not fully step-free. Assistance is available through help points and dedicated staff, who are ready to provide guidance from early morning until late at night. For those who need it, an induction loop is provided, enhancing communication for hearing aid users.
Although waiting rooms are absent, the station offers seated areas for comfort. For refreshments, facilities are available, although the station lacks an ATM, shops, or currency exchange services. Cyclists are supported with 84 bicycle spaces located at a cycle hub by the entrance. However, it's worth noting that cycle hire options are not available directly at the station.

Sunbury railway station serves the town of Sunbury-on-Thames, a charming community in the county of Surrey, England. Operating primarily as a commuter station, Sunbury is in the residential district and offers travellers a convenient launchpad to the bustling heart of London and other popular destinations. The station has a ticket office operating Monday to Friday from 06:40 to 13:30, and Saturdays from 08:00 to 14:00. Tickets can also be conveniently bought or collected from the available ticket machines. For those requiring a little extra, accessible ticket machines provide ease for everyone, offering disc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ders.
While Sunbury station might not have some of the more luxurious amenities like waiting rooms with first-class lounges, accessible toilets, or refreshment facilities, it does provide some essential services. You can make use of the induction loops installed for hearing aid users, and there are helpful information points for those rare perplexing travel moments. While there is no staffed help available, courtesy of the onboard train guard, assistance for boarding and alighting is readily accessible.
Wondering how to get around once you've reached Sunbury? You're not alone. Fortunately, Sunbury station boasts substantial links with other means of transport, providing bus services that can whisk you away to nearby areas, such as Fulwell or Shepperton. Rail replacement services are conveniently located at the Green Street bus stops.
Despite the lack of extensive disability parking and absence of accessible taxis, the station does have steps in place for accessibility with near-level access to platforms, plus a singular accessible parking spot. If cycling is your preferred mode of traversal, storage for 22 bicycles is available, including racks on Platform 1.
